  • Malaysian Street Food Delight - Nasi Kandar | Kok Siong Nasi Kandar Penang @ Pusat Bandar Puchong
    Nasi kandar is a popular northern Malaysian dish, which originates from Penang. It was popularized by Tamil Muslim traders from India. It is a meal of steamed rice which can be plain or mildly flavored, and served with a variety of curries and side dishes.
    Location:
    Kok Siong Nasi Kandar Penang (Restoran Kok Siong)
    45, Jalan Bandar 16, Pusat Bandar Puchong, 47100 Puchong, Selangor
    Business Hours:
    10am to 4pm (Daily)
